PoPRuns / LiveSplit.POPTLC

2 stars 1 forks source link

Splitter pausing 20 seconds into the run but only sometimes #18

Closed TheDementedSalad closed 7 months ago

TheDementedSalad commented 7 months ago

Is there an existing issue for this?

Did you install the autosplitter via the LiveSplit UI?

Expected Behaviour

Timer not supposed to pause when the player says "None of you will leave here alive"

Actual Behaviour

Timer pausing when player says "None of you will leave here alive" sometimes

https://www.youtube.com/watch?v=7NElGOhrJLg&t=32s

This specific video shows it working.

First block of log is it not pausing

Second block of log is it pausing at this point

Link to a video with DebugView output.

7RAYD.LOG

Log output

00000250    48.78984451 [17500] [Prince of Persia: The Lost Crown] activeScene: KIN_BAT_02 -> KIN_BAT_04    
00000251    48.83814621 [17500] LiveSplit.exe Information: 0 :  
00000252    48.83816147 [17500] [Prince of Persia: The Lost Crown] level: KIN_BAT_02 -> KIN_BAT_04  
00000253    48.83817673 [17500] LiveSplit.exe Information: 0 :  
00000254    48.83818436 [17500] [Prince of Persia: The Lost Crown] shortLevel: BAT_02 -> BAT_04     
00000255    48.83826065 [17500] LiveSplit.exe Information: 0 :  
00000256    48.83826447 [17500] [Prince of Persia: The Lost Crown] [2] State set changed.   
00000257    48.83827972 [17500] LiveSplit.exe Information: 0 :  
00000258    48.83828735 [17500] [Prince of Persia: The Lost Crown]   GameFlowStateDefault   
00000259    48.83830261 [17500] LiveSplit.exe Information: 0 :  
00000260    48.83831024 [17500] [Prince of Persia: The Lost Crown]   GameFlowStateGame  
00000261    48.85113144 [17500] LiveSplit.exe Information: 0 :  
00000262    48.85115051 [17500] [Prince of Persia: The Lost Crown] [3] State set changed.   
00000263    48.85116577 [17500] LiveSplit.exe Information: 0 :  
00000264    48.85118103 [17500] [Prince of Persia: The Lost Crown]   GameFlowStateDefault   
00000265    48.85119247 [17500] LiveSplit.exe Information: 0 :  
00000266    48.85120773 [17500] [Prince of Persia: The Lost Crown]   GameFlowStateGame  
00000267    48.85121918 [17500] LiveSplit.exe Information: 0 :  
00000268    48.85123062 [17500] [Prince of Persia: The Lost Crown]   GameFlowStateCutScene  
00000269    55.47770691 [17500] LiveSplit.exe Information: 0 :  
00000270    55.47773361 [17500] [Prince of Persia: The Lost Crown] [2] State set changed.   
00000271    55.47774124 [17500] LiveSplit.exe Information: 0 :  
00000272    55.47775269 [17500] [Prince of Persia: The Lost Crown]   GameFlowStateDefault   
00000273    55.47776794 [17500] LiveSplit.exe Information: 0 :  
00000274    55.47777176 [17500] [Prince of Persia: The Lost Crown]   GameFlowStateGame  
00000275    56.65466309 [17500] LiveSplit.exe Information: 0 :  
00000276    56.65468216 [17500] [Prince of Persia: The Lost Crown] activeScene: KIN_BAT_04 -> UIManager     
00000277    56.65472031 [17500] LiveSplit.exe Information: 0 :  
00000278    56.65473175 [17500] [Prince of Persia: The Lost Crown] inputMode: 0 -> 1    
00000279    56.65482712 [17500] LiveSplit.exe Information: 0 :  
00000280    56.65484238 [17500] [Prince of Persia: The Lost Crown] [3] State set changed.   
00000281    56.65485382 [17500] LiveSplit.exe Information: 0 :  
00000282    56.65486908 [17500] [Prince of Persia: The Lost Crown]   GameFlowStateDefault   
00000283    56.65488052 [17500] LiveSplit.exe Information: 0 :  
00000284    56.65489197 [17500] [Prince of Persia: The Lost Crown]   GameFlowStateGame  
00000285    56.65490723 [17500] LiveSplit.exe Information: 0 :  
00000286    56.65491867 [17500] [Prince of Persia: The Lost Crown]   GameFlowStateMenu  
00000287    58.06958008 [17500] LiveSplit.exe Information: 0 :  
00000288    58.06959534 [17500] [Prince of Persia: The Lost Crown] activeScene: UIManager -> KIN_BAT_04     
00000289    59.57654953 [17500] LiveSplit.exe Information: 0 :  
00000290    59.57657623 [17500] [Prince of Persia: The Lost Crown] inputMode: 1 -> 0    
00000291    59.57667923 [17500] LiveSplit.exe Information: 0 :  
00000292    59.57669067 [17500] [Prince of Persia: The Lost Crown] [2] State set changed.   
00000293    59.57670975 [17500] LiveSplit.exe Information: 0 :  
00000294    59.57672501 [17500] [Prince of Persia: The Lost Crown]   GameFlowStateDefault   
00000295    59.57673645 [17500] LiveSplit.exe Information: 0 :  
00000296    59.57674789 [17500] [Prince of Persia: The Lost Crown]   GameFlowStateFirstLoading  
00000297    59.58442307 [17500] LiveSplit.exe Information: 0 :  
00000298    59.58444214 [17500] [Prince of Persia: The Lost Crown] [3] State set changed.   
00000299    59.58446884 [17500] LiveSplit.exe Information: 0 :  
00000300    59.58448792 [17500] [Prince of Persia: The Lost Crown]   GameFlowStateDefault   
00000301    59.58450699 [17500] LiveSplit.exe Information: 0 :  
00000302    59.58451843 [17500] [Prince of Persia: The Lost Crown]   GameFlowStateFirstLoading  
00000303    59.58452988 [17500] LiveSplit.exe Information: 0 :  
00000304    59.58454514 [17500] [Prince of Persia: The Lost Crown]   GameFlowStateTitleScreen   
00000305    59.83905411 [17500] LiveSplit.exe Information: 0 :  
00000306    59.83907318 [17500] [Prince of Persia: The Lost Crown] activeScene: KIN_BAT_04 -> Bootstrap     
00000307    61.05841827 [17500] LiveSplit.exe Information: 0 :  
00000308    61.05842590 [17500] [Prince of Persia: The Lost Crown] activeScene: Bootstrap -> GameManager    
00000309    61.50883865 [17500] LiveSplit.exe Information: 0 :  
00000310    61.50887680 [17500] [Prince of Persia: The Lost Crown] inputMode: 0 -> 1    
00000311    69.16152954 [16500] 00.14.06.315 49   AudioDeviceSession OnStateChanged Active *SystemSounds {0.0.0.00000000}.{e5b44193-b436-4553-bbfa-8d9f1fb9ed16}|#%b{A9EF3FD9-4240-455E-A4D5-F2B3301887B2}|1%b#     
00000312    70.48361969 [16500] 00.14.07.637 48   AudioDeviceSession OnStateChanged Inactive *SystemSounds {0.0.0.00000000}.{e5b44193-b436-4553-bbfa-8d9f1fb9ed16}|#%b{A9EF3FD9-4240-455E-A4D5-F2B3301887B2}|1%b# 

00000346    102.59141541    [17500] [Prince of Persia: The Lost Crown] level: KIN_BAT_04 -> KIN_BAT_02  
00000347    102.59145355    [17500] LiveSplit.exe Information: 0 :  
00000348    102.59146118    [17500] [Prince of Persia: The Lost Crown] shortLevel: BAT_04 -> BAT_02     
00000349    102.59156036    [17500] LiveSplit.exe Information: 0 :  
00000350    102.59156799    [17500] [Prince of Persia: The Lost Crown] [2] State set changed.   
00000351    102.59158325    [17500] LiveSplit.exe Information: 0 :  
00000352    102.59159851    [17500] [Prince of Persia: The Lost Crown]   GameFlowStateDefault   
00000353    102.59160614    [17500] LiveSplit.exe Information: 0 :  
00000354    102.59161377    [17500] [Prince of Persia: The Lost Crown]   GameFlowStateGame  
00000355    102.67815399    [17500] LiveSplit.exe Information: 0 :  
00000356    102.67815399    [17500] [Prince of Persia: The Lost Crown] inputMode: 0 -> 3    
00000357    102.67828369    [17500] LiveSplit.exe Information: 0 :  
00000358    102.67829132    [17500] [Prince of Persia: The Lost Crown] [3] State set changed.   
00000359    102.67831421    [17500] LiveSplit.exe Information: 0 :  
00000360    102.67831421    [17500] [Prince of Persia: The Lost Crown]   GameFlowStateDefault   
00000361    102.67832947    [17500] LiveSplit.exe Information: 0 :  
00000362    102.67834473    [17500] [Prince of Persia: The Lost Crown]   GameFlowStateGame  
00000363    102.67835236    [17500] LiveSplit.exe Information: 0 :  
00000364    102.67836761    [17500] [Prince of Persia: The Lost Crown]   GameFlowStateCutScene  
00000365    105.02867126    [17500] LiveSplit.exe Information: 0 :  
00000366    105.02871704    [17500] [Prince of Persia: The Lost Crown] inputMode: 3 -> 0    
00000367    105.02941895    [17500] LiveSplit.exe Information: 0 :  
00000368    105.02945709    [17500] [Prince of Persia: The Lost Crown] [2] State set changed.   
00000369    105.02954865    [17500] LiveSplit.exe Information: 0 :  
00000370    105.02976990    [17500] [Prince of Persia: The Lost Crown]   GameFlowStateDefault   
00000371    105.02981567    [17500] LiveSplit.exe Information: 0 :  
00000372    105.02983093    [17500] [Prince of Persia: The Lost Crown]   GameFlowStateGame  
00000373    105.03215027    [17500] LiveSplit.exe Information: 0 :  
00000374    105.03218842    [17500] [Prince of Persia: The Lost Crown] True     
00000375    105.03221130    [17500] LiveSplit.exe Information: 0 :  
00000376    105.03224182    [17500] [Prince of Persia: The Lost Crown] False    
00000377    105.03226471    [17500] LiveSplit.exe Information: 0 :  
00000378    105.03227234    [17500] [Prince of Persia: The Lost Crown] False    
00000379    105.03231049    [17500] LiveSplit.exe Information: 0 :  
00000380    105.03231049    [17500] [Prince of Persia: The Lost Crown] KIN_BAT_02   
00000381    105.03243256    [17500] LiveSplit.exe Information: 0 :  
00000382    105.03246307    [17500] [Prince of Persia: The Lost Crown] 0    
00000383    105.03248596    [17500] LiveSplit.exe Information: 0 :  
00000384    105.03254700    [17500] [Prince of Persia: The Lost Crown] 1F41DBB41C0  
00000385    105.03258514    [17500] LiveSplit.exe Information: 0 :  
00000386    105.03259277    [17500] [Prince of Persia: The Lost Crown] 2    
00000387    105.03263092    [17500] LiveSplit.exe Information: 0 :  
00000388    105.03265381    [17500] [Prince of Persia: The Lost Crown] 1F4F3AC6800  
00000389    105.03267670    [17500] LiveSplit.exe Information: 0 :  
00000390    105.03269196    [17500] [Prince of Persia: The Lost Crown] quests: 1    
00000391    105.03293610    [17500] LiveSplit.exe Information: 0 :  
00000392    105.03294373    [17500] [Prince of Persia: The Lost Crown]   QUEST COUNT: 1, ACTIVE: 1  
00000393    105.03308868    [17500] LiveSplit.exe Information: 0 :  
00000394    105.03310394    [17500] [Prince of Persia: The Lost Crown]   QUEST: Persia Under Attack [e36c64cd5a982ce4b8571f8190c1ad43] (Main? False) at 0x1F5A4B28400   
00000395    105.03884125    [17500] LiveSplit.exe Information: 0 :  
00000396    105.03886414    [17500] [Prince of Persia: The Lost Crown] QUEST LIST CHANGED 1 -> 1 (SQ: 0 )   
00000397    105.03891754    [17500] LiveSplit.exe Information: 0 :  
00000398    105.03893280    [17500] [Prince of Persia: The Lost Crown]   Persia Under Attack    
00000399    105.03894806    [17500] LiveSplit.exe Information: 0 :  
00000400    105.03896332    [17500] [Prince of Persia: The Lost Crown] Quest started! Persia Under Attack   
00000401    105.03898621    [17500] LiveSplit.exe Information: 0 :  
00000402    105.03899384    [17500] [Prince of Persia: The Lost Crown] SEEN QUESTS (1):     
00000403    105.03900909    [17500] LiveSplit.exe Information: 0 :  
00000404    105.03902435    [17500] [Prince of Persia: The Lost Crown]   Persia Under Attack    
00000405    127.22601318    [17500] LiveSplit.exe Information: 0 :  
00000406    127.22602081    [17500] [Prince of Persia: The Lost Crown] [3] State set changed.   
00000407    127.22605133    [17500] LiveSplit.exe Information: 0 :  
00000408    127.22607422    [17500] [Prince of Persia: The Lost Crown]   GameFlowStateDefault   
00000409    127.22609711    [17500] LiveSplit.exe Information: 0 :  
00000410    127.22611237    [17500] [Prince of Persia: The Lost Crown]   GameFlowStateGame  
00000411    127.22613525    [17500] LiveSplit.exe Information: 0 :  
00000412    127.22615051    [17500] [Prince of Persia: The Lost Crown]   GameFlowStateChangingLevel     
00000413    127.54168701    [17500] LiveSplit.exe Information: 0 :  
00000414    127.54169464    [17500] [Prince of Persia: The Lost Crown] activeScene: KIN_BAT_02 -> KIN_BAT_04    
00000415    127.58962250    [17500] LiveSplit.exe Information: 0 :  
00000416    127.58963013    [17500] [Prince of Persia: The Lost Crown] level: KIN_BAT_02 -> KIN_BAT_04  
00000417    127.58966827    [17500] LiveSplit.exe Information: 0 :  
00000418    127.58968353    [17500] [Prince of Persia: The Lost Crown] shortLevel: BAT_02 -> BAT_04     
00000419    133.58001709    [19120] [2024.01.18-22.15.10:734][ 52]LogPortalPublishTime: Extending playtime segment: 638412120106900000 - 638412127307300000 (new: 638412129107340000) for app 34e23808223248d5bdc8297d08e7fa72 (1e5a766cf84b4417b5e0593404530865)   
00000420    133.58033752    [19120] [2024.01.18-22.15.10:734][ 52]LogPortalPublishTime: Saving playtime for item: 34e23808223248d5bdc8297d08e7fa72 (1e5a766cf84b4417b5e0593404530865)   
00000421    133.58036804    [19120] [2024.01.18-22.15.10:734][ 52]LogPortalPublishTime:  Segment: 638412120106900000 - 638412129107340000   
00000422    133.58038330    [19120] [2024.01.18-22.15.10:734][ 52]LogPortalPublishTime: Segment is the start of playtime    
00000423    134.20959473    [17500] LiveSplit.exe Information: 0 :  
00000424    134.20960999    [17500] [Prince of Persia: The Lost Crown] [2] State set changed.   
00000425    134.20964050    [17500] LiveSplit.exe Information: 0 :  
00000426    134.20965576    [17500] [Prince of Persia: The Lost Crown]   GameFlowStateDefault   
00000427    134.20967102    [17500] LiveSplit.exe Information: 0 :  
00000428    134.20968628    [17500] [Prince of Persia: The Lost Crown]   GameFlowStateGame
mitchell-merry commented 7 months ago

Please try the branch here: https://github.com/LiterallyMetaphorical/LiveSplit.POPTLC/pull/20

mitchell-merry commented 7 months ago

I've had someone else try and they say this is fixed now. Let me know on discord if this is wrong.